If you’ve ever enjoyed a burger at East Dallas’ Goodfriend Beer Garden and Burger House, you’ve likely been disappointed to discover it wasn’t open for lunch. Not even on weekends.

But no more! As of today at 11 a.m., Goodfriend will be open for lunch Friday to Monday. SideDish broke the news late last month. The restaurant will roll out a new menu to go along with their new hours.

The move is one way they’re ensuring they sell more food than alcohol to comply with the zoning for their zip code. So it’d be nice if you ordered more food than beers, at least at the lunch hour. If you can’t do that, at least bring along a few friends to balance your drinks out.
